Fiba World Cup Qualification Americas

FIBA World Cup Qualification, Americas is the top-tier regional route to the FIBA Basketball World Cup, bringing together national teams from North, Central, and South America and the Caribbean. This multi-stage qualifying event blends group play, home-and-away fixtures, and knockout rounds, with different paths to the World Cup based on results and standings. The format emphasizes depth and pressure, rewarding teams that combine skill, defense, and pace across windows in the lead-up to the world tournament. It is more than a series of games; it is a national project with direct berths at stake, possible repechage options, and pride on basketball’s global stage. The qualification cycle runs through several FIBA windows each season, with group games in autumn and winter and decisive knockout bouts later in the cycle. Notable powers in the region include the United States, Canada, Argentina, Brazil, the Dominican Republic, Puerto Rico, and Mexico, along with emerging teams. The Americas has a storied history of upsets and breakthroughs, shaping the World Cup field and regional rivalries. Fans follow the Americas qualifiers for national pride, dramatic finishes, and a preview of the stars who will illuminate the world stage, while arenas pulse with home‑court energy and hopeful rosters.
